The potential role of RNA N6-methyladenosine in Cancer progression

TL;DR: This review focuses on the physiological functions of m6A modification and its related regulators, as well as on the potential biological roles of these elements in human tumors.

CircRNAs: biogenesis, functions, and role in drug-resistant Tumours.

TL;DR: The role of circRNAs in the chemotherapeutic resistance of tumours is reviewed, the latest advances in circRNA research are presented and the various mechanisms underlying their regulation are summarized.

Translatable circRNAs and lncRNAs: Driving mechanisms and functions of their translation products.

TL;DR: The mechanisms that drive translation of circRNAs and lncRNAs are reviewed and the research methods and tools available to identify their translation products and validate the function of these bioactive proteins/peptides in physiology and cancer are discussed.

Identification of hsa_circ_0001821 as a Novel Diagnostic Biomarker in Gastric Cancer via Comprehensive Circular RNA Profiling.

TL;DR: Hsa_circ_0001821 may prove to be a new and promising potential biomarker for GC diagnosis and play a potential regulatory role in GC at the posttranscriptional level.
